Output 69f7076629ae5ccef96eae20fd37db76885ce0025b98520dc5645c9d2bdb4f32:9

value
391688
script pubkey
OP_0 OP_PUSHBYTES_20 0913a53d2bfba12f9191745ce668acba707bce68
address
bc1qpyf620ftlwsjlyv3w3wwv69vhfc8hnngt644n8
transaction
69f7076629ae5ccef96eae20fd37db76885ce0025b98520dc5645c9d2bdb4f32
confirmations
164032
spent
true